3D Anaglyph plugin/filter for FCP?

Does anyone know of an Alaglyph (red/blue) filter that will work inside Final Cut Pro?

After Effects has the "3D Glasses" plug-in, but it won't work on an Intel Mac in FCP.

Any thoughts? I prefer to keep everything native without exporting media to a 3rd party piece of software.

BTW, I did figure out a way to do it that isn't terribly difficult once you do the first one. I found a similar method for Photoshop and stereo still photos and applied the concept to FCP.
  1. Place the RIGHT side image on V1
  2. Place the LEFT side image on V2

  3. Align the subject by temporarily bringing V2's opacity to 50% and adjusting the x,y position of one or both of the clips. Return V2 clip to 100% opacity.
  4. Place the LEVELS filter on V1 RIGHT clip and select RED. Bring the Output and tolerance to 0.

  5. Place the LEVELS filter on V2 LEFT clip and select BLUE. Bring the Output and tolerance to 0.
  6. Place the LEVELS filter on V2 LEFT clip and select GREEN. Bring the Output and tolerance to 0.

  7. CTRL-click the LEFT clip (V2) and select SCREEN MODE.

That's it. Now you can copy and paste attributes. I'd still love this to be in plug-in form though.

try to make the two stream in two different file, and make those files with stereoscopic player realtime in anaglyph! Or something similar player for MAC!
If not, you get color compresson that looks bad (ghost) for 3d
(every compresson use this method divx, xvid, qt, wmv...)
